Product Details
The PORTWEST BZ12 Bizweld Cape Hood provides reliable flame-resistant protection in high-risk environments. With a self-fabric drawcord, this cape hood is designed for a secure, comfortable fit. It should be paired with a suitable coverall or jacket and trousers for optimal safety.
Key Features and Benefits
- Heat Protection: Provides certified protection against radiant, convective, and contact heat.
- Molten Metal Splash Resistance: Built to resist molten metal splash, increasing user safety in hazardous conditions.
- Comfortable Fit: Self-fabric drawcord allows for easy adjustment, ensuring a comfortable and secure fit.
- UV Protection: 40+ UPF-rated fabric blocks 98% of UV rays, ideal for outdoor applications.
- Certifications:
- CE-CAT III: Ensures compliance with stringent safety standards.
- CE Certified: Meets international standards for safety and quality.

Common Questions
Is flame resistant clothing the same as heat resistant clothing?
Not always. Flame resistance, radiant heat protection and contact heat protection are different performance needs, so match the garment to the actual hazard.
Can it be worn with other PPE?
Yes. Confirm that the garment does not interfere with gloves, safety footwear, helmets, respirators, eye protection or fall-protection equipment required for the same task.
